diff --git a/packages/webview_flutter/webview_flutter_ohos/ohos/src/main/ets/io.flutter.plugins/webview_flutter/OhosWebView.ets b/packages/webview_flutter/webview_flutter_ohos/ohos/src/main/ets/io.flutter.plugins/webview_flutter/OhosWebView.ets index 834b83e8bf06ea088b46a824a384c51ee49b3c4a..299064999ee2a81237dcc341cb276278741fa13c 100644 --- a/packages/webview_flutter/webview_flutter_ohos/ohos/src/main/ets/io.flutter.plugins/webview_flutter/OhosWebView.ets +++ b/packages/webview_flutter/webview_flutter_ohos/ohos/src/main/ets/io.flutter.plugins/webview_flutter/OhosWebView.ets @@ -45,6 +45,7 @@ export struct OhosWebView { controller: this.controller, renderMode: RenderMode.SYNC_RENDER }) + .keyboardAvoidMode(WebKeyboardAvoidMode.RESIZE_VISUAL) .backgroundColor(this.webView.getWebSettings().getBackgroundColor()) .onDownloadStart(this.webView.onDownloadStart) .onPageBegin(this.webView.onPageBegin)